StorageGRID maintenance procedure stalls due to SSH Keys mismatch
Applies to
NetApp StorageGRID
Issue
The precheck operation has detacted conditions that must be addressed before upgrading. Resolve the issues listed below and click Start Upgrade or Run Prechecks to retry. Contact Technical Support for assistence in resolved these issues if necessary.
The following issues were identified by the Connectivity precheck
- <nodename> is currently offline or disconnected
- Refer to KB article "StorageGRID 11.x software upgrade resolution guide for further information

When revieving the /var/local/log/gdu-server.log
on Primary Admin, it reports:
E, [2020-09-24T02:02:45.190142 0008297] ERROR -- : Failed to execute sh command with 'run-host-command test -e /var/local/dkr/0/install/upgrade-stage/base-os/upgrade.sh 2>&1' on localhost - 1, /usr/local/lib/site_ruby/bycast/commands/sh.rb:134:in `rescue in block in call': Unable to connect to 127.0.0.1 on port 8022: fingerprint SHA256:0rY4mOtq8XtRYciMQuZL9Oo+EFp568s2CYx5+qvDxvk does not match for "[127.0.0.1]:8022" (Bycast::Commands::Sh::Remote::Error)
from /usr/local/lib/site_ruby/bycast/commands/sh.rb:109:in `block in call'
from /usr/local/lib/site_ruby/bycast/commands/sh.rb:108:in `synchronize'
from /usr/local/lib/site_ruby/bycast/commands/sh.rb:108:in `call'
from /usr/sbin/run-host-command:117:in `<main>'
Example 2:
ECDSA host key for <hostname> differs from the key for the IP address <ip>